What the Brisbane white card is, and who needs it

The white card is the across the country identified proof that you have actually finished building and construction induction training. The current device of competency is CPCWHS1001 Prepare to function securely in the building and construction sector. It covers the fundamentals that everyone on a site have to comprehend: danger monitoring, reporting, signs, personal safety devices, and emergency response.

If you will be on a building and construction site in Queensland, you need it. That consists of labourers, pupils, certified professions, engineers, surveyors, project managers, shipment chauffeurs that get in website borders, and visitors who execute work tasks during site examinations. Volunteers and work experience trainees require it also if they will certainly remain in any location where building and construction work occurs.

A common false impression is that workplace personnel who "just see for conferences" are exempt. If they go into the construction area, also for a brief walkdown, they count as employees under the legislation and need legitimate induction.

Can you finish a white card online in Brisbane?

This is where many individuals get tripped up. Queensland's regulatory authority has long needed that RTOs providing white card training to Queensland learners supply it face to face. Some other states have actually allowed on-line shipment sometimes, which produced a confusing market of "white card online Brisbane" promises.

Here is the useful, conventional strategy that keeps you out of difficulty:

    If you live and work in Queensland, publication an in person Brisbane white card training course with a Queensland-approved licensed training organisation. You will certainly be assessed in person. You will certainly also carry out functional presentations that can not be done effectively by clicking through a web module. You might see interstate companies marketing on-line alternatives. Some websites will certainly turn down those cards at gateway, particularly significant contractors and government jobs in Queensland that adhere to the regulatory authority's advice strictly. Do not take the chance of showing up on day one only to be transformed around.

If you have an authentic remote work scenario or unique condition, speak to the RTO or examine the Work Health and wellness Queensland website for existing regulations. They transform occasionally, and any kind of exemptions are tightly specified. For most Brisbane workers, in person is the common and the best bet.

Assessment without surprises

Assessment for the white card is proficiency based. You need to show that you can use what you found out, not simply remember definitions.

image

You will complete a composed or computer-based expertise element. Anticipate short response questions, recognition of indications and icons, and situation feedbacks. You will certainly additionally carry out jobs such as:

    Selecting and correctly fitting PPE, including a construction hat and eye protection. Demonstrating safe handling of a fundamental tool or tool suitable to induction level. Pointing out dangers in a photo spread or a simulated site zone, after that discussing exactly how you would control them. Explaining just how to report a threat or case to the ideal individual in clear language.

Reasonable changes are permitted if they do not alter the competency end result. Additional time, bigger print materials, and one-on-one clarification are common. Having another person give answers or equate evaluation reactions verbatim is typically not allowed, due to the fact that the system needs you to communicate about safety yourself.

What takes place after you complete the course

On successful completion you get immediate evidence, normally a declaration of achievement for CPCWHS1001 and a course conclusion receipt. Maintain electronic copies on your phone. Numerous Brisbane websites will approve this interim evidence for a restricted duration while your plastic white card is printed and mailed.

The physical card usually arrives within 2 to 3 weeks to the address you provided. Hold-ups happen, normally due to address errors or postal issues. If you get to the three week mark without distribution, call your provider initially. They can check issuance and reissue if necessary.

Your white card does not have a collection expiration day. However, if you have actually not accomplished building and construction benefit two or even more successive years, Queensland expects you to renovate the induction prior to going back to a website. That refresher expectation is practical. Regulations change. Products and techniques change. Your habits get rusty.

Common risks that cost time at website gate

Over the years, the same avoidable issues come up.

Mismatched details. If your enrolment makes use of a nickname or a different spelling, your card prints this way. Website safety and security then stops working to match your permit, EBA card, or VOCs. Utilize your complete lawful name everywhere.

image

No USI on the day. Without a USI, the RTO can not issue your declaration in the national system. Establish it up the evening before and keep it with your ID photos.

Thin assessment. A five-minute PPE trial where half the course views from the back row does not prepare you for a manager who expects you to find exclusion zones around mobile plant. Select deepness over speed.

Online to conserve money. It can backfire if the principal specialist in Brisbane declines it, particularly on government and tier-one sites. What you saved in fees, you lose in unpaid downtime.

Lost card, no backup. Take clear photos of both sides of your card and your declaration of attainment. If your budget goes missing, you can maintain functioning while your substitute is processed.

If your card is damaged, lost, or your details change

Your very first telephone call is to the RTO that provided the card. They can prepare a substitute or give documents for a name change after marriage or various other life events. If the RTO no longer runs, call Work Health and Safety Queensland for recommendations on acquiring a replacement or proof of training. Keep your point-in-time proof obtainable. Screenshots and scans have actually conserved many Monday starts.

Can you stop working a white card course?

Yes, and it is the ideal result if a person can not show secure fundamentals or rejects to engage. Falling short does not imply you are disallowed from construction forever. It suggests you require more time, more clear language, or additional practice. Great service providers supply a totally free or reduced-fee resit within a short home window and will certainly tell you exactly what to improve.
